As the maxims stand, there may be an overlap, as regards the length of what
one says, between the maxims of quantity and manner; this overlap can be
explained (partially if not entirely) by thinking of the maxim of quantity
(artificial though this approach may be) in terms of units of information. In
other words, if the listener needs, let us say, five units of information from
the speaker, but gets less, or more than the expected number, then the
speaker is breaking the maxim of quantity. However, if the speaker gives the
five required units of information, but is either too curt or long-winded in
conveying them to the listener, then the maxim of manner is broken. The
dividing line however, may be rather thin or unclear, and there are times
when we may say that both the maxims of quantity and quality are broken

The first analysis of maxim started when Peter Parker arrived at home and
having a conversation with Aunt May & Uncle Ben.
[later at home with his aunt, referring to his beat up looking face]
Aunt May: Oh, my God! What happened to your face?
Peter Parker: Oh, I'm alright. I just...I fell, skating. It's alright.
[Peter's uncle walks into the kitchen carrying an looking box]
Peter lied to her aunt because he didnt want aunt may to be worried of him
by being has an injuries in his face. In this case, peter violates the maxim
rules of quality because he didnt talk the truth about the real condition. He
was injured because Flash, his friend hit him, not because of fell in skating as
he said.

Peter at the beginning wants to see Dr. Connor, but when the receptionist
said if he was an internship worker, he just agree and lies that he was in
internship now, but in fact not. The real person that was in internship in
Oscorp was Mr. Guevara. In this case, Peter violates the rules of maxim
quality because he lied again and didnt say anything that he wasnt an
internship worker.
